Nollywood star, Tuvi James, ready for pre-album launch
After a long wait, handsome Nollywood star and biker, Tuvi James, who just breezed in from South Africa, is now poised for the pre launch of his forthcoming album.
Entitled: Tuvi on fire, the anticipated evening of fun, relaxation and groove holds tomorrow, Saturday inside celebrity hangout, O'Jez, National Stadium, Surulere, Lagos, under the chairmanship of Olorogun Oscar Ibru, CEO, IBRU Organizations.
Powered by Victorist Production (Pretoria, South Africa), in collaborations with Ejike Asiegbu-led Forever Communications and Trend Blazers Entertainment, the event according to them promises to be memorable and riveting for all the expected guests and friends of James coming.
Elaborating more on the pre launch, Mr. Asiegbu, a popular actor and the immediate past national president of the Actors Guild of Nigeria, disclosed that the outing had been carefully planned with inputs from their foreign partners who are equally storming Nigeria with all their representatives. “Tuvi, myself and the boss of Trend Blazers met recently with our foreign partners in South Africa and concluded that we should have a pre album launch, before releasing the full album early next year.
And we agreed that it must hold in Nigeria first before any other country. Tuvi is a young man that has done well for himself in Nollywood and we are very sure he will replicate same feat in the music industry. We believe so much in his creative ability hence, the need to work with him,” added Asiegbu, now a Special Assistant to Abia State Governor, Theodore Orji.
